WebMar 26, 2024 · Esophageal myotomy (or Heller myotomy) is a procedure that can be performed to treat a lower esophageal sphincter that fails to relax (e.g. achalasia ). The procedure involves a longitudinal incision of the distal esophageal musculature to break the sphincter tone. A fundoplication wrap can be performed to restore some patency to …

WebFeb 14, 2024 · In 1913, Ernest Heller reported the first successful cardiomyotomy for achalasia. [ 1] He used 8-cm parallel myotomies (anterior and posterior). These were considered extensive, and in 1918, De Brune Groenveldt and Zaaijer described the single incision known today.
